Texas Instruments and Delta Electronics Partner to Enhance EV Power Systems

Texas Instruments (TI) and Delta Electronics are joining forces to advance power electronics for electric vehicles (EVs), starting with the development of a more efficient 11 kW onboard charger. This partnership, based in Taiwan, marks a significant step towards enhancing EV performance and affordability through cutting-edge technology.
